The global media manufacturing service market, valued at $4,856.6 million in 2025, is projected to experience robust growth, driven by the burgeoning biopharmaceutical and cell culture industries. A Compound Annual Growth Rate (CAGR) of 6.1% from 2025 to 2033 indicates a significant expansion, fueled by increasing demand for advanced therapies, personalized medicine, and vaccine development. The market segmentation reveals strong growth in custom media manufacturing services, catering to the specific needs of research and development, and cGMP (current Good Manufacturing Practice) media manufacturing services, crucial for large-scale biopharmaceutical production. Cell culture applications dominate the market, followed by biopharmaceutical and vaccine production segments, all benefiting from the rising prevalence of chronic diseases and global health concerns. Key players like Thermo Fisher Scientific, Merck Millipore, and Sartorius are leveraging their technological advancements and established distribution networks to capitalize on this growth. Geographic analysis suggests North America and Europe hold significant market shares, owing to the presence of established biopharmaceutical companies and robust regulatory frameworks. However, the Asia-Pacific region is poised for substantial growth driven by expanding research infrastructure and increasing investments in biotechnology. The market's continued expansion is expected to be influenced by factors such as technological innovations in media formulation, increasing regulatory scrutiny, and the rising adoption of automation in manufacturing processes.
The competitive landscape is characterized by both large multinational corporations and specialized smaller companies. Larger companies benefit from economies of scale and established distribution channels, while smaller, specialized firms offer customized services and niche solutions. The market is expected to witness strategic alliances, mergers, and acquisitions as companies strive to expand their product portfolios and geographic reach. Future growth will depend on the continued development of innovative media formulations tailored to specific cell lines and therapeutic applications, as well as the ongoing implementation of advanced manufacturing technologies to enhance efficiency and reduce costs. Stringent regulatory compliance will continue to be a crucial factor influencing market dynamics, along with the ongoing need for cost-effective and high-quality media to support the booming biopharmaceutical sector.

Several factors contribute to the rapid expansion of the media manufacturing service market. Firstly, the explosive growth of the biopharmaceutical industry, particularly in areas like biologics and cell-based therapies, fuels the demand for large-scale, high-quality media production. This demand outstrips the capacity of many companies to produce media in-house, leading to increased reliance on specialized service providers. Secondly, the stringent regulatory environment, particularly surrounding cGMP compliance, necessitates outsourcing to companies with established quality control systems and expertise in regulatory compliance. This ensures product consistency and safety, crucial for biopharmaceutical and vaccine production. Thirdly, the increasing complexity of cell culture media formulations and the need for customized solutions for specific cell lines and applications further drives the market growth. Specialized manufacturers possess the technology and expertise to develop and manufacture highly specialized media, optimizing cell growth, product yield, and overall process efficiency. Finally, the increasing adoption of single-use technologies in biopharmaceutical manufacturing simplifies production, reduces contamination risks, and enhances scalability, all boosting the demand for external media manufacturing services. These factors collectively create a dynamic and expanding market poised for continued growth in the coming years.
Despite the significant growth potential, the media manufacturing service market faces certain challenges. Maintaining consistent product quality and complying with stringent regulatory requirements like cGMP represent considerable hurdles. Meeting the diverse and often highly specific needs of various clients necessitates flexible manufacturing processes and significant investment in research and development. The high cost of specialized equipment and skilled personnel can increase production costs, impacting profitability. Competition from established players and emerging companies necessitates continuous innovation and the development of superior products and services. Supply chain disruptions, especially concerning raw materials, can significantly impact production timelines and costs. Furthermore, managing the complexities associated with handling large volumes of biomaterials, ensuring sterility, and preventing cross-contamination requires advanced infrastructure and strict quality control procedures. Finally, the need for robust quality control and documentation throughout the manufacturing process adds further complexity and expense. Addressing these challenges effectively is critical for sustainable growth and market leadership in this dynamic sector.
